毕业设计救星?用 AI 一键生成 Java/Python 毕设源码+论文,这套流程真香!
⏰ 温馨提示:本文适用于正在为毕业设计头秃的计算机专业同学,以及需要快速搭建原型的开发者。阅读时间约 5 分钟,文末有彩蛋。
前言:毕设季的“至暗时刻”
又到了一年一度的毕设季,朋友圈里的计算机专业同学状态出奇一致:
- 选题选到头秃,不知道做什么;
- 搭建环境报错一天,Hello World 还没跑通;
- 数据库表设计得乱七八糟;
- 论文初稿憋不出来,Word 里只有标题。
作为一个过来人,深知那种面对空白 IDE 的无力感。最近在 Github 和技术社区冲浪时,发现了一个挺有意思的工具——智码方舟。它打出的口号很吸引人:“AI 毕设生成器,一键生成全栈项目”。
为了验证它到底是“科技与狠活”还是“人工智障”,我亲自上手测了一把,看看它能否真的拯救我们的毕设。
一、 初体验:一句话生成一个系统?
打开网站,界面很简洁。核心功能就是通过对话来构建项目。
作为测试,我输入了一个经典的毕设题目:“基于 Spring Boot 的图书管理系统”。
这里大家可以根据自己的选题输入,比如“校园二手交易平台”、“疫情防控系统”、“企业人事管理系统”等,这也是 CSDN 上搜索量最大的几类毕设。
输入需求后,神奇的一幕发生了。AI 并没有直接甩给我一堆乱码,而是像一个真正的产品经理一样,先梳理了需求:
- 确认技术栈(我选了 Java + Spring Boot + Vue,经典且稳妥)。
- 生成数据库表结构(用户表、图书表、借阅记录表等)。
- 生成前端页面和后端接口。
整个过程大概持续了几分钟。生成完成后,系统提示可以进行在线预览。
*](https://i-blog.csdnimg.cn/direct/4efe610a2b674cc390d08506b6988d54.png)
不得不说,看到界面出来的那一刻,心里踏实了一半。界面不是那种简陋的纯 HTML,而是带有侧边栏、导航栏和图表的标准后台风格,这对于毕设答辩来说,第一印象分直接拉满。
二、 深度评测:生成的代码能打吗?
毕设最核心的还是代码。如果代码跑不起来,或者逻辑不通,界面再好看也是白搭。
1. 代码规范性
我下载了生成的源码压缩包。解压后的目录结构非常清晰:
- 后端:标准的 Maven 项目结构,Controller、Service、Mapper 分层明确。
- 前端:Vue 项目,组件化开发,代码格式化做得不错。
- 数据库:提供了完整的
.sql脚本,直接导入 MySQL 即可。
这对于被导师吐槽“代码像面条”的同学来说,简直是福音。规范的目录结构是答辩时的加分项。
2. 技术栈覆盖
我测试的是 Java 技术栈,据说它还支持 Python (Django/Flask)、React、微信小程序、H5 甚至小游戏。基本上涵盖了目前主流的毕设选题方向。
3. 核心亮点:文档与论文
这大概是这个工具最“狠”的地方。
✅ 毕设全流程交付源码、论文初稿、数据库脚本以及部署文档
生成的压缩包里竟然真的包含了一份论文初稿(Word 格式)。虽然不能直接提交(查重你懂的),但它提供了非常完整的章节框架:需求分析、系统设计、数据库设计、详细实现等。这对于不知道论文怎么下笔的同学来说,相当于给了写作大纲,剩下的就是填空和润色。
三、 实战建议:如何利用 AI 高效完成毕设?
工具虽好,但我想给各位学弟学妹提个醒:AI 是辅助,不是替代。
拿到智码方舟生成的代码后,建议做以下几步“二次加工”,让你的毕设真正变成自己的:
- 本地跑通是底线:按照提供的部署文档,在本地把项目跑通。这是答辩演示的基础。
- 二改功能:在生成的标准 CRUD(增删改查)基础上,加一个稍微复杂点的功能,比如“数据可视化图表”或“导入导出 Excel”。这能体现你的工作量。
- 读懂代码:导师提问时,如果连自己系统的接口在哪都不知道就尴尬了。利用 AI 生成的代码作为学习材料,搞清楚前后端是怎么交互的。
- 论文润色:将生成的论文初稿作为骨架,结合自己的修改过程,填充具体的实现细节和截图。
四、 总结
经过这一番折腾,我对这类 AI 生成工具有了新的认识。它不是让你偷懒什么都不做,而是帮你扫清了“从 0 到 1”最痛苦的那些障碍——环境搭建、框架搭建、基础代码生成。
如果你正在为毕设选题发愁,或者卡在代码实现的瓶颈期,不妨试试这个思路,或许能打开新的局面。
🎁 彩蛋 & 资源获取
为了方便大家体验,我把传送门放下面了:
👉 传送门:智码方舟 - AI 毕设生成器
使用小贴士:
- 题目描述越详细,生成的系统越符合预期(比如加上“需要包含数据可视化模块”)。
- 支持在线预览,觉得满意了再下载,避免浪费时间。
如果觉得本文对你有帮助,请一键三连(点赞、收藏、关注)!你的支持是我更新的最大动力!
更多推荐


所有评论(0)